MvPolynomial.optionEquivLeft_symm_C_C
∀ (R : Type u) (S₁ : Type v) [inst : CommSemiring R] (x : R), (MvPolynomial.optionEquivLeft R S₁).symm (Polynomial.C (MvPolynomial.C x)) = MvPolynomial.C x
